Job description

We are seeking skilled Mechanical Works Train Technicians to join our team. In this role, you will undertake preventative and corrective mechanical maintenance on a variety of Works Train rail plant equipment, including locomotives, wagons, MEWPs, Hiabs, and road vehicles such as PSV and light commercial vehicles.

Key Responsibilities
  • Perform mechanical maintenance and repairs on rail plant equipment and service vehicles.
  • Configure and deliver Works Train equipment.
  • Drive locomotives within worksites safely and efficiently.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ve issues across all Works Train equipment and associated vehicles.
  • Understand and respect Health and Safety and operational procedures.
  • Perform planned maintenance of electro‑mechanical equipment in accordance with approved diagnostic procedures and instructions to ensure equipment is returned to service in a safe and timely manner.
  • Undertake fault diagnostic work and perform consequential corrective maintenance of electro‑mechanical equipment in accordance with approved diagnostic procedures and instructions to ensure the equipment is returned to service in a safe and timely way.
  • Understand and participate in the preparation of equipment for service, including inspection and testing to meet customer demands.
  • Configuration of Works Train equipment as required.
  • Operation of Works Train equipment and Locomotives within worksites.
  • Record and report equipment performance against agreed instructions and schedules.
  • Learn relevant computerised administrative systems.
  • Become qualified in the use of all relevant equipment (e.g. locomotives, MEWPs, HP wash, vacuum and drainage modules, electrical, PSV vehicles, forklifts, etc).
Qualifications and Experience
  • HND/HNC qualification or equivalent in a mechanical or domestic/automotive role, however, a relevant qualification at BTEC / NVQ Level 3 or equivalent may be considered if combined with relevant work experience in a technical environment.
  • Previous experience of working in an electrical or mechanical environment is essential.
  • Experience in motor vehicle maintenance including light commercial and PSV including vehicle diagnostics an advantage.
  • The ability to communicate in both English and French would be an advantage.
  • A full UK Driving Licence is essential.
  • A valid Passport is required for this role.
